Cast of Characters
Ali and Hamid: The two brothers who help Kamila (âRoyaâ) grow her business by being steady customers. They are kind, honest, and hardworking, and become an indispensable outlet for Kamilaâs sewing groupâs clothing. Because of the chadri Kamila wore, Ali and Hamid never saw Kamila during the time she worked with them. It was not until years later that Hamid and Kamila met by accident. She recognized him and introduced herself.
Mahbooba and Hafiza: Two UN Habitat workers who recruit Kamila for the UNâs Womenâs Community Forum. Hafiza, who trained as a scientist, and the no-nonsense Mahbooba, heard about Kamila though her cousin, Rukhsana.
Mahnaz: One of Kamilaâs first students, Mahnazâs dreams of becoming an educator are on hold during the Talibanâs five-and-a-half year ban on education for girls. After resuming her education, she went on to become a professor at a Kabul university. Her sister, who also sewed with Kamila, went on to become a doctor.
Dr. Maryam: A dedicated physician, Dr. Maryam treats Kabulâs women in an office she rents from the Sidiqis. She is brave and fairly outspoken about her frustration with the Taliban. Eventually, she strikes a deal of sorts with the Taliban: she will treat only women, and the Taliban will leave her practice alone. As doctors flee Afghanistan and hospitals lose funding, Dr. Maryam is often the only medical professional women in Kamilaâs neighborhood can turn to. After the fall of the Taliban, she moved with her family to Helmand province in southern Afghanistanâa Taliban stronghold. Surprisingly, the Taliban welcomed her, and even sent their wives and daughters to her to be treated.
Mr. Sidiqi: The patriarch of the Sidiqi family, Mr. Sidiqi is a former Afghan military officer. He served the Afghanistan government during the tumultuous years before the Taliban took over. He is intelligent, educated, and well traveled, and he believes strongly in the importance of education for all people, including women. After the fall of the Taliban, he continues to live in the north in Parwan with his wife and is proud of their successful and ambitious children.
Mrs. Sidiqi: The matriarch of the Sidiqi family, Mrs. Sidiqi raised eleven children. Although not an obviously powerful figure, she is reflected in her childrenâs independence, resilience, and loyalty. Like her husband, Mrs. Sidiqi believes her children are capable of great things. She lives in Parwan with her husband.
Kamila Sidiqi: Kamila is the young woman at the center of this book. As of 2017, she is the deputy chief of staff for administration and finance at the presidentâs office in the Islamic Republic of Afghanistan government. Now, married with a son, Kamila was just 19 years old when the Taliban forced her and every other teenage girl and woman in Kabul to remain in their homes unless accompanied by a male chaperone. She is smart, positive, driven, kind, and dedicated to helping her country and its citizens prosper, especially the women.
